Systemd

是否安裝了 systemd 自動掛載點?

  • February 15, 2020

mountpoint即使systemd未掛載自動掛載,也會報告掛載點:

% mountpoint /media/ssd
/media/ssd is a mountpoint
% mount | grep /media/ssd
systemd-1 on /media/ssd type autofs (rw,relatime,fd=35,pgrp=1,timeout=0,minproto=5,maxproto=5,direct,pipe_ino=13618)

如何判斷掛載點是否實際自動掛載?

0僅當$dir已安裝時才會返回:

dir=/media/ssd
systemctl is-active --quiet "$(systemd-escape -p --suffix=mount "$dir")"

您可以簽入/etc以查看auto.master文件中的內容,然後檢查所有其他auto.*文件(如果您或任何人為您創建了這些文件)。

基本上,如果您有最後一行中所述的 autofs - 它是自動掛載的。

引用自:https://unix.stackexchange.com/questions/566126